The size of Surrey Hills is approximately 4.4 square kilometres. There are 13 parks, covering nearly 3.4% of the total area. The population of Surrey Hills in 2016 was 13605 people. By 2021 the population was 13655 showing a population growth of 0.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Surrey Hills is 50-59 years. Households in Surrey Hills are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Surrey Hills work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 76.50% of the homes in Surrey Hills were owner-occupied compared with 76.30% in 2016.
